To be successful in this role, you should have below skills:
Candidate should have minimum 8+ years of working experience on Windows Servers
Hands on experience on Windows Server OS 2016,2019 and 2022.
Experience on Windows server cluster and troubleshooting on cluster issues.
Experience on Windows server security updates and product lifecycle.
Good understanding and knowledge on Windows Server PowerShell scripting.
Should have understanding on local/domain polices and troubleshooting on issues related to windows network.
Knowledge on Antivirus solutions like – MDE, Symantec AV.
Observability and Monitoring.
Some other highly valued skills may include below:
Experience on either of automation technologies – Ansible AAP, Chef
Experience/ understanding on Git commands, Jenkins pipeline, GitLab.
MCSE/MCSA, ITIL certification.
